10k is really not as bad as it sounds for a boxster. Parts prices from the dealer are astronomical and that quote likely includes labour which is also very expensive at the dealer. If you buy used parts and shop wisely I wouldn't be surprised if you could put all the parts together for like 2k, if that. Oh and for the sound you're looking for I'd probably just get some test pipes (if you can't find the cats at a reasonable price) and a stock exhaust. Top speed has a price for forum members that is a fraction of the cost of the fabspeed pipes. OEM exhaust shouldnt be too hard to find either - lots of people took theirs off in favour of aftermarket ones.
